Output 20edd95c95a57457bed7faef1d2df9c0e95b3b2eb4fa496a2a05f589f1d7988e:8

value
6506517
script pubkey
OP_0 OP_PUSHBYTES_20 c8b11e0bcf3d23c019ee9f0ae3ee85f1f15238d5
address
bc1qezc3uz70853uqx0wnu9w8m5978c4ywx4spkmsn
transaction
20edd95c95a57457bed7faef1d2df9c0e95b3b2eb4fa496a2a05f589f1d7988e